Photo: Li Jianguo/Zuma PressThe economy expanded at a 4.9% annual pace in the third quarter—more than double than in the second quarter—the Commerce Department reported Thursday.

Overall gross domestic product, reported as a seasonally- and inflation-adjusted rate, and consumer spending both recorded the fastest pace since late 2021.This copy is for your personal, non-commercial use only.
